The Inter-American Investment Corporation (IIC) is the private sector lending arm of the Inter-American Development Bank Group (IDBG). The Public Private Synergies Division of the IIC facilitates cooperation between the IDB and the IIC and generates knowledge products that promote strategic focus and impact. The division manages coordination with the IDB at the country, regional, and sector levels.
 
Public private partnerships have become one important area of work that the IDB Group is undertaking to close the infrastructure gap in the region, one of the priorities in the IIC’s business plan. Closing this gap requires an increase in public and private financing. The IIC will endeavour to help optimize the private financing mechanisms fostering PPP developments.

  • Lead the day to day management of project teams, or consulting firms, working on the provision of services including: d
    • Delivering whole project structuring package (engineering, socio-environmental, legal, financial modelling, communications, promotion activities)
    • Project Management Office (PMO) advisory: government clients provide all technical parts and IIC coordinates a consistent implementation approach towards leading project to market.
    • Bankability Assessment: once concession agreement drafts are ready, IIC provides comprehensive assessment regarding the risk matrix and financial model accuracy as well as best practices adoption.
    • Support in market sounding / improved promotion efforts: support government clients in the screening of market attractiveness and its key drivers and/or deal-breakers to maximize competition.
    • Advisory in private initiatives / unsolicited proposals: provide qualified third-party assessments on value-for-money and public interest degree of private submitted proposals and studies. Support government clients for the most appropriate private initiative choice
    • Strategic advisory to private clients: support private clients on their bidding strategy, reviewing financial model and advising clients during bidding stage (Q&A, financial model validation, competitive intelligence on market players)
